ZENB Jambalaya Penne Pasta
SERVES 6
PREP TIME 15 minutes
COOK TIME 40 minutes
TOTAL TIME 55 minutes

INGREDIENTS
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 small onion, finely chopped
- 2 medium red or green bell peppers, chopped
- 2 links andouille sausage, cut into 1/4-inch slices
- 2 bo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-size pieces
- 1 teaspoon Cajun seasoning
- 1/2 teaspoon each kosher salt & ground black pepper
- 2 cloves garlic, sliced
- 12 ounces ZENB Yellow Pea Penne Pasta, uncooked
- 1 can (14.5 ounces) diced tomatoes
- 3 cups low-sodium chicken broth
- 1 pound medium shrimp, peeled, deveined (31/35 count)
- 1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
- 2 tablespoons chopped Italian parsley
INSTRUCTIONS
1.Heat oil in large heavy skillet on medium-high heat. Cook onions and peppers 4-5 minutes until tender-crisp. Add sausage, chicken, Cajun seasoning, salt and pepper. Cook 8-10 minutes stirring frequently, until chicken starts to brown.
2.Stir in garlic slices, ZENB Pasta, tomatoes and broth. Bring mixture to a boil. Reduce heat to medium; simmer 13-15 minutes until pasta is tender.
3.Add shrimp; cook 3-4 minutes until opaque. Stir in cheddar cheese; mix gently until melted and well combined. Garnish with parsley before serving.
Tasty Tips
Substitute leftover cooked chicken to save time.
